From the age of 5 until the age of 15, Monenna Kennedy attended Newbrooke with her siblings.
-
Monenna McHugh is believed to be either the far right, or the second to the far right. Monenna is the second oldest daughter of the McHugh lineage. There is no date when this photograph was taken, but based on 10/13 children born at this time, it is likely this was between 1940-1943.
-
From age 15-18, Monenna studies the Catholic faith in addition to health science as a profession.
-
Monenna McHugh is certified from the University of South Hampton, England.
-
Monenna was only a licensed Nurse and Midwife in England, meaning she needed to apply and register for a license transition in Kenya. During this time, Monenna served as a Nun, guiding the locals through darkness.

Monenna Kennedy(formerly McHugh), admitted by the Nurse' and Midfwife council of Kenya, in part to serve and use the title. (3/14/1960)

Monenna tends to the sick, and reportedly delivers over 5 thousand children during her 4 year period as a Midwife in Africa.
-
Out of an Existential crisis, Monenna leaves the convent in Africa to pursue her own family. Her family living in Europe disapprove of her decision, yet she immigrates regardless of their views. Monenna does not return to Europe until the death of her father in 1969.
-
Monenna McHugh Married WIlliam Michael Kennedy in 1966 in Long Island, New York. 2 children are born, Tracy and Dennis Kennedy, With William Kennedy passing away from cancer in 1986
-
The State of New York grants and Authorizes Monenna Kennedy as a professional and registered Nurse, established December 9th, 1966.
-
On April 2nd, 1971, the Supreme Court of Suffolk County, New York, approves Monenna Kennedy's citizenship.
